Login to POS as a manager or owner, go to Start> Users> Users. A window opens with a list of the users. At the top left corner of the window is “Add a new user. [NEVER ADD USER WHO HAS WORKED AT ANY MRJIMS.PIZZA STORE. THEY ARE STILL IN THERE. CALL MRJIM].” Click on that and the “Add new user” window opens. Enter the team member’s complete information. Click on the small arrow next to “Permissions” to expand the list and then select the permissions for the team member. Then click the arrow next to pay rates to expand that list and enter the rates. When a new friend is added, their password is set to first letter of first name and last name in full, all lowercase. Mine would be set to jjohnson. When POS is in the Inside Role it does not allow payments to be applied to Pick-Up orders. Pick-up orders are not usually paid for when the order is placed. On the rare occasion where a pick-up order does need to be paid for; after the order is placed you go to the Current Order screen, click on the order, then click the Payments option at the top of the list. If you can’t see a team member or ex-team member on the list, just give them at least one permission. Go to Start> Users> Users and then click on Options on the right next to the wrench icon. Then click Inactive Users> Show.
